"Punitive damages" are figures meant to punish the company. They aren't really to say "this person deserved $125m" or "this person was robbed of $125m of value", but rather to say "your actions were so bad you should have to pay $125m on top so you learn your lesson".

Basically, the idea is that if Walmart can get away with doing something illegal occasionally, with only a small cost when someone fights back, then it would generally be worth it to keep their shitty and illegal practice going as standard procedure.

Just gonna math nerd a bit here.

FWIW, something like "the chance no shoulder ever drop for x runs" isn't quite (7/8)^X. It's actually asking the question "the chance to drop anything else (including nothing) x times in a row", which looks more like (1-(7/8))^X -subtract from 1 again to get the original question.

So let's do the math under this lens:

  • There's a flat 60% chance to not get an item on a given run.
  • Of the times you do, you will not get the prize for 7/8 rolls.

Together these are 0.6 + (0.4 * (7/8)) = 0.95, so a 95% chance to not get that specific piece in a given run.

Then for 30 runs we do 0.95 ^ 30, which comes out to ~21% chance to "get anything but the prize every time", or ~79% chance to get the piece you're aiming for.

And if we consider an average of 1 additional plate wearer per run, then we can simply bump that math to 0.95 ^ 60, or ~4.6% chance to "get anything but the prize every time".

This is all under the assumption that nobody can get selected for the same loot twice in one run. I haven't done mythic+ in forever so I don't honestly remember, and google isn't giving me a straight answer.

The part I love about these complex processes is how much of that engineering happens before they even reach the conveyor. From how the materials are mixed to be uniform, how they're formed, cut, etc... so much of the process involved is concerned with making the inputs as consistent as possible.

Then this step on its own looks surprisingly simple because it's able to assume so many things about its input. Thanks to how consistent those inputs are, this step is far simpler, more robust, and probably a lot faster than if it needed to be concerned with more variable inputs.

It looks different when a slot is locked.

The problem is the mod "(-10—10)% reduced Charm Charges used" which becomes "1-10% increased Charm Charges used" while negative.

Thawing Charm has "Consumes 40 of 40 Charges on use". So if your ingenuity increases the # of charges used past 40, it becomes impossible to use because you'll never have enough charges available to pay the cost.
